JOB SUMMARY

Under the direction the Commercial Services Manager, the Centre Head is responsible for planning, organizing, directing, controlling and coordinating the activities of the SRH centre.  S/he ensures the effective and efficient delivery of services of the centre and is also responsible to supervise, lead and motivate the centre staff. Coordinate and supervise the work and activities of service providers and non-service providers working in the center.

DUTIES/TASKS

Specific Roles and Responsibilities

Business Leadership and Team Management

  • Take lead in overall coordination of center activities to ensure efficient delivery of quality services and achievement of MSI Ethiopia’s mission and center business targets.

  • Responsible for team spirit and productivity management by on job coaching, motivation and continuously set and reviewing performance targets for the center staff.

  • Responsible for financial sustainability and continuous growth of the center business by ensuring center service promotion, service diversification and efficient management of available resources.

  • Ensure effective implementation of initiatives like client referral scheme, waiver scheme, client centric care, center branding guideline and any other future business development strategies planned.

  • Assess the private sector activity and propose possible solutions for business challenges.

Resource Management and Administration

  • Responsible for managing all human resource related issues according to MSIE HR policy

  • Responsible for planning and efficient management of supply chain and logistic related issues of the center.

  • Follows-up stock management by their proper receipt, storage, safe keep, issuance and regular replenishment by pre-establishing re-order level;

  • Responsible for monthly expense planning and ensure all financial transactions of the centre are in line with the MSIE financial policies.

  • Approves supplies' requests and issuance and authorizes financial payments for purchase of goods and services as per the organization's financial policy and delegation of authority;

  • Performs other administrative duties essential for the day-to-day running of the clinic;

Client Centric Care and quality assurance

  • Support service providers delivering quality clinical services under technical supervision of health officer.

  • Builds customer relation management skills and/or capacity of the Centre team members;

  • Ensure best quality of clinical care by regular monitoring, competency assessment, training of service providers with support from Health officer and clinical quality and training department.

  • Ensure on-time report for the clinical incident happened in the center as per the guideline of MSIE.

  • Enforces MSIE Infection Prevention Standards for clinic.

  • Ensure Maintenance of a safe, clean, orderly, and pleasant Clinic environment;

  • Ensures the maintenance of efficient delivery of client centric care and the confidentiality of all cases, in accordance with accepted standard medical practices and professional code of conduct.

Reporting, decision making and partnership management

  • Responsible for preparing and sharing weekly/monthly/quarterly reports of KPI, financial and stock report of the center at support office as per agreed time schedule.  

  • Ensures client records are up-to-date, orderly, properly filed and readily retrievable for reference and inspection as per MSIE standards.

  • Identifies problems which interfere with practice and develops an action plans for resolution.

  • Practices effective problem identification and resolution skills as a method of sound decision making.

  • Build up strong relations with local government and non-governmental agencies to promote MSIE's interest and partnership at local level.

  • Ensure effective collaboration and synergies established with MSIE other business activities in the town/region.

  • Undertakes any other relevant duties that assigned by line manager/department director.
